首頁 > Java > java教程 > 主體

Java泛型的簡單實例

高洛峰
發布: 2017-01-18 11:15:52
原創
1138 人瀏覽過

package com.chase.test;
import java.util.ArrayList;
import java.util.Hashtable;
import java.util.List;
public class testT {
    public static <T> void main(String[] args) {
        testT classT = new testT();
        List<T> find = classT.find(0, 10);
        if (find != null && find.size()>0) {
            for (T integer : find) {
                System.out.println(integer);
            }
        }
//        showList();
    }

    public static <T> void showList() {
        testT classT = new testT();
        List<T> find = classT.find(0, 10);
        for (T t : find) {
            System.out.println(t);
        }
    }

    public <T> List<T> find(int begin, int end) {
        List<T> list = new ArrayList<T>();
        list.add((T)new Integer(222));
        list.add((T)"111");
        list.add((T)"昨天是重阳节!");
        return list;
    }
}
 
class TestGen0<K,V>{ 
      public Hashtable<K,V> h=new Hashtable<K,V>(); 
      public void put(K k, V v) { 
       h.put(k,v); 
      } 
      public V get(K k) { 
       return h.get(k); 
      } 
      public static void main(String args[]){ 
       TestGen0<String,String> t=new TestGen0<String,String>(); 
       t.put("key", "value"); 
       String s=t.get("key"); 
       System.out.println(s); 
      } 
    }
登入後複製

testT 輸出:

222
111
昨天是重陽節!

TestGen0輸出:
value

更多Java泛型的簡單實例相關文章請關注PHP中文網!

相關標籤:
來源:php.cn
本網站聲明
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n
熱門教學
更多>
最新下載
更多>
網站特效
網站源碼
網站素材
前端模板
關於我們 免責聲明 Sitemap
PHP中文網:公益線上PHP培訓,幫助PHP學習者快速成長!